New dinosaur unveiled today at Drexel U., Philadelphia, PA, USA.

I was actually the sound guy for the press conference today. Kind of a big deal if you think about it. Proud to be a part of it, if even in a small way:


UPDATE: Here's the local CBS affiliate's coverage, and some of my staff can be seen cleaning up during the overhead shot of the reporter walking int he blue floor outline of the dino:

